  • I did my arsenal inventory

    I did some deep inventory of my Meguiar's detailing arsenal and found some interesting products.



    M81 Hand Polish, M16 Professional Paste Wax and D114 Rinse-Free Express Wash.

    M81's gloss is easily on that level of Ultimate Polish or Menzerna's SF3500/SF3800. I will use it again soon as the last product before protection step. I must thank Mike Stoops again for that product as he was my mentor in that direction. Thanks, Mike, it keeps on shinning.

    I sadly only have two cans of M16 left, as it is a part of my winter protection combo: Ultimate Paste Wax/M16. Now we have Ultimate Fast Finish which may be used on top for this extra time.

    D114 Rinse-Free Express Wash is an older version, before D115 was introduced. Before paint correction work, where no wax is needed during washing process, it may become handy again. I remember it leaving paint surface quite glossy though.



    I also found this old bottle of Ultimate Wash & Wax. The color has changed to dark yellow. I wonder if it's still good to go. I'll give it a good shake for couple minutes before putting it to work.



    The picture above clearly shows how the first bottle's liquid is much darker.

    Sometimes I use Ultimate Wash & Wax in my foam gun. It's not as foamy as Meguiar's Super Soap, which is my favorite product for foam guns, but it works okay.
    Ultimate Wash & Wax plus Ultimate Quik Wax is a great shortcut combo for that "just detailed" look.

    Re: I did my arsenal inventory

    greg, regarding the darkened G17748, if anything, it would never hurt to use the product. sometimes color change can occur through shelf life or beyond shelf life.
